创建数据库表包括什么意思
-
创建数据库表是指在关系型数据库中定义一个新的数据表结构,用于存储和组织数据。创建表是数据库设计的重要环节,它定义了表的名称、列名、数据类型、约束条件等信息,为后续的数据存储和查询提供了基础。
以下是创建数据库表的一些重要意义和步骤:
-
数据结构定义:创建数据库表是定义数据结构的一种方式。通过创建表,可以明确指定每个列的数据类型,如整数、字符、日期等,以及每个列的约束条件,如主键、外键、唯一性约束等。这样可以确保数据的完整性和一致性,并提供更高效的数据存储和查询。
-
数据存储和组织:创建数据库表可以将数据按照一定的结构进行存储和组织。表由行和列组成,每行表示一个数据记录,每列表示一个数据字段。通过创建合适的表结构,可以使数据更加有序、易于管理和查询。
-
数据查询和操作:创建数据库表后,可以对表中的数据进行查询、插入、更新和删除等操作。通过使用SQL语言,可以方便地对表进行各种操作,实现对数据的灵活处理。
-
数据关系建立:通过创建数据库表,可以建立不同表之间的关系。通过定义外键约束,可以实现表之间的引用和关联,从而实现数据的关系模型,如一对一、一对多和多对多等关系。
-
数据安全性保障:创建数据库表时,可以设置各种约束条件和权限控制,以保证数据的安全性。通过定义表的访问权限和数据操作权限,可以限制用户对表的操作,保护数据不被非法访问和篡改。
创建数据库表的步骤通常包括:确定表的名称和列名,定义每个列的数据类型和约束条件,设置主键和外键关系,确定表的其他属性(如索引、默认值等),最后执行创建表的SQL语句。在创建表之前,需要进行数据库设计和规划,确定表的结构和关系,以满足数据存储和查询的需求。
1年前 -
-
创建数据库表是指在数据库中定义一个新的表格,用于存储和组织数据。在创建数据库表之前,需要确定表的名称、字段以及字段的数据类型和约束等信息。
创建数据库表的意义在于:
- 存储数据:数据库表是存储和组织数据的基本单元,通过创建表可以将数据按照特定的结构和规则进行存储,方便数据的管理和查询。
- 组织数据:创建数据库表可以将数据按照一定的关系和结构进行组织,例如将用户信息存储在一个用户表中,商品信息存储在一个商品表中,通过表之间的关联可以方便地进行数据的查询和分析。
- 数据约束:创建数据库表时可以定义字段的数据类型和约束,例如定义字段的长度、是否允许为空、唯一约束等,可以保证数据的完整性和准确性。
- 数据查询和分析:创建数据库表后,可以通过SQL语句对表中的数据进行查询、排序、过滤和统计等操作,方便进行数据分析和业务逻辑实现。
- 数据安全:创建数据库表时可以设置访问权限和安全约束,限制用户对表的操作,保护数据的安全性。
在创建数据库表时,需要考虑以下几个方面:
- 表的名称:选择一个有意义且符合命名规范的表名,表名应该能够清晰地反映出表的含义和用途。
- 字段和数据类型:确定表中需要存储的字段,以及每个字段的数据类型,例如整数、字符串、日期等。
- 字段约束:定义字段的约束条件,例如是否允许为空、是否唯一、是否自增等。
- 主键和索引:确定表的主键,用于唯一标识表中的每一条记录,同时可以创建索引来提高数据查询的效率。
- 外键和关联:如果有需要,可以在表之间建立关联关系,通过外键来实现数据的关联和一致性维护。
- 数据完整性:考虑数据的完整性和一致性,通过设置约束条件和触发器等机制来保证数据的有效性和准确性。
- 数据库性能:在创建表时,需要考虑表的设计是否能够满足业务需求,并且能够提供高效的数据查询和操作性能。
总之,创建数据库表是数据库设计的重要环节,通过合理的表结构设计和约束设置,可以提高数据的管理效率、数据的安全性和查询性能,从而满足业务需求。
1年前 -
创建数据库表是指在数据库中创建一个新的数据表,用于存储和组织数据。数据库表是数据库中的一种数据结构,它由多个列和行组成。每个列代表一个属性,每个行代表一个记录。
创建数据库表需要指定表的名称以及每个列的名称和数据类型。通过创建表,可以定义数据表的结构,包括列的名称、数据类型、长度、约束等。创建数据库表是数据库设计和管理的重要步骤之一。
下面是创建数据库表的一般步骤:
-
设计表结构:确定需要存储的数据,并确定每个数据字段的名称和数据类型。根据需求,可以定义主键、外键、默认值、约束等。
-
使用SQL语句创建表:使用数据库管理系统(如MySQL、Oracle、SQL Server等)提供的SQL语句,使用CREATE TABLE语句创建表。语法通常如下:
CREATE TABLE 表名 (
列1 数据类型 [约束],
列2 数据类型 [约束],
…
);例如,创建一个名为"students"的表,包含id、name和age三个列,其中id为主键,name和age的数据类型分别为VARCHAR和INT,可以使用以下语句:
CREATE TABLE students (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T
); -
执行创建表语句:将创建表的SQL语句发送给数据库管理系统执行,即可在数据库中创建相应的表。
-
可选的操作:根据需要,可以对表进行其他操作,如添加索引、修改表结构、添加数据等。
创建数据库表是数据库设计的重要环节,需要根据实际需求来设计表结构,合理定义数据类型和约束,以确保数据的完整性和一致性。同时,创建数据库表也需要遵循数据库管理系统的语法规则和约束。
1年前 -